Fine grinding, to P80 sizes as low as 7 μm, is becoming increasingly important as mines treat ores with smaller liberation sizes. This grinding is typically done using stirred mills such as the Isamill or Stirred Media Detritor. While fine grinding consumes less energy than primary grinding, it can still account for a substantial part of a mill's energy budget. Overall energy use and media ...

In tower mills such as those manufactured by Kubota in Japan and the Metso Vertimill, steel balls or pebbles are placed in a vertical grinding chamber in which an internal screw flight provides medium agitation. One feature of tower mills is that they normally operate their stirrers at a relatively slow velocity (less than 3 m/s tip speed).

The power ingesting of a grinding process is 5060% in the cement production power consumption. The Vertical Roller Mill (VRM) reduces the power consumption for cement grinding approximately 3040% associated with other grinding mills.

Vertical roller mill for cement and slag grinding • Energy consumption: 70 % of a ball mill for cement 50 % of a ball mill for slag • Fineness: max. 4 500 cm²/g for cement max. 6 000 cm²/g for slag • Moisture required for stabilising the grinding bed less influence on cement quality • Lowwearcosts • Throughput up to 300 t/h

Figure shows the difference in energy efficiency between a laboratory ball mill and a stirred mill grinding a gold ore using 6 mm diameter alumina balls as media. At a fine grind size there is a clear advantage in energy consumption for a stirred mill over the tumbling mill. However, as the grind size coarsens, the difference in specific energy required to achieve the grind lessens.

Vertical Roller Mill The vertical roller mill (VRM) shown in Figure 4 is an air swept, mediumspeed, vertical pulverizer with integral classifier. It pulverizes coal by applying hydraulicallyloaded grinding pressure through three grin ding rollers onto a rotating bed of coal. Grinding pressure can be adjusted to account for variations in coal

The mill consistently uses five to ten percent less power than other cement vertical roller mills, and in comparison with traditional ball mill operations, the energy requirements for the OK cement mill is 3045 percent lower for cement grinding and 4050 percent lower for slag.

The difference between ball mill and vertical mill in cement grinding Over the last three decades the vertical roller mill has become the preferred ball mill for grinding of raw materials. The grinding efficiency of the vertical roller mill combined with an ability to dry, grind and classify within a single unit gives the vertical roller mill a decided advantage over a ball mill system.

The specific power consumption for these two ball shapes is shown in Fig. 16. For N≤75% there is no change in the mill power draw. This occurs because the center of mass of the charge is little changed by the particle shape at these speeds. At intermediate speeds, the power draw for the noncircular balls falls off rapidly.
